Job Description:

The Hardware Services group within Mainframe Delivery is responsible for the Design, Deploy and Support of our Mainframe Hardware Infrastructure including CPUs, Coupling Facilities, DASD, Tape systems and their related connections and management consoles. We are responsible for capacity planning for Mainframe Hardware especially as it relates to CPU capacity and for monitoring and tuning the performance of the z/OS systems. We are responsible for Mainframe Data Replication as it relates to our capabilities to perform Disaster Recovery. We also provide consultation services with Architects, Infrastructure Specialists and application developers on system and application design as it relates to the performance of these systems.
